Evolução complexa de um meio-gráben: seção rifte da Bacia de Campos baseada em análise sismoestratigráfica

Patrycia Ene; Renata Alvarenga; David Iacopini; Karin Goldberg

The rift section in the Campos Basin, comprises the basal and median portions of the Lagoa Feia Group, and includes the main source rocks in the basin, as well as carbonate reservoir rocks. Interpretation and systematic mapping of 2D seismic lines across two main half-grabens, integrated with lithological well-log data, allowed the construction of a chronostratigraphic chart and an evolutionary model for the initial phase of this basin. Ten seismic stratigraphic units, with corresponding bounding surfaces, and three seismic facies were defined, representing the main lithological groups in the rift section: border fault deposits, fine grain-dominated re-sedimented deposits and coarse grain-dominated re-sedimented deposits. The Campos Basin stratigraphy was subdivided in tectonic systems tracts, which reflect its tectonostratigraphic evolution. The rift initiation systems tract presents a well distributed tectonic. The high tectonic activity systems tract is marked by the significant fault movement. Finally, the low tectonic activity systems tract is characterized by processes of fault restriction. Analysis of each evolutionary step led to a tectonostratigraphic model. Initially, the rift sediments were deposited in synformal depression with no border fault. With continuation of the rifting process, deformation was concentrated along main faults, which led to the development of two half-grabens structure with defined border faults and increasing tectonics. This phase was followed by a stage of incipient fault movement until the cessation of rifting. Basin filling was thus complex and interdependent in the different troughs during the development of the Campos Basin.

Análise sismoestratigráfica da seção rifte da Bacia de Santos, Brasil

Andrea Arias Ramirez; Renata Alvarenga; Claiton M. S. Scherer; Karin Goldberg

The Santos Basin, despite its surmount significance due to the pre-salt reservoirs, has limited geological information well-logs, 3D seismic or good quality 2D seismic for the rift section. The present work aims at integrating seismic stratigraphic analysis and proposing a tectonic-stratigraphic evolution model for the rift section of the basin. Seismic stratigraphic analysis involved interpretation of reflectors, which is the base of seismic stratigraphic units identification and seismic facies characterization. The result was the definition of 16 seismic stratigraphic units, four seismic facies (including the sag ), and the development of chronostratigraphic charts of events adapted to the seismic context. Based on the adaptation of the stacking patterns to tectonic activity changes model, it was possible to delimit the rift initiation system tract, the high tectonic activity system tract, the low tectonic activity system tract and the post-rift, represented by the sag . The development of each tectonic system tract responded to variations in controlling factors of the lacustrine basin, interpreted as the relative balance between the rate changes in the accommodation space generated by tectonic and sediment supply influenced by climate.

Modelo deposicional do Membro Ipubi (Bacia do Araripe, nordeste do Brasil) a partir da caracterização faciológica, petrográfica e isotópica dos evaporitos

Fabia Emanuela Rafaloski Bobco; Karin Goldberg; Tatiana Pastro Bardola

As rochas evaporiticas se destacam nos estudos sedimentologicos e estratigraficos por sua associacao com rochas geradoras de petroleo como rochas selantes e por seu significado paleoclimatico e paleoambiental. A caracterizacao faciologica e petrografica quantitativa permitiu a definicao das facies e habitos dos evaporitos do Membro Ipubi da Bacia do Araripe, coletados em afloramentos localizados principalmente na regiao de Araripina, Pernambuco. Tecnicas de difratometria de raios X (DRX) e microscopia eletronica de varredura (MEV) foram utilizadas com o intuito de complementar a analise dos aspectos composicionais e texturais dos constituintes. Os sulfatos dominantes sao gipsita e anidrita, localmente celestita. Foram identificadas macroscopicamente tres facies (Evaporito laminado, Evaporito macico e Evaporito fraturado) e microscopicamente treze habitos para os sulfatos. Dentre estes, os habitos e as texturas primarios sao anidrita nodular, gipsita palicada e chevron , estas duas ultimas constituindo a textura laminada. Os demais sulfatos foram precipitados em condicoes pos-deposicionais rasas. As analises isotopicas de S e O nos sulfatos forneceram valores de δ 34 S entre +10,27‰ e +17,99‰ e δ 18 O entre +7,72‰ e +13,30‰, caracterizando a composicao marinha da salmoura geradora dos depositos. Os resultados obtidos indicam que os evaporitos do Membro Ipubi foram depositados em contexto subaquoso (salinas) e intrasedimentar em um sabkha costeiro.

Reconhecimento e análise das fácies sísmicas nas sucessões rift das bacias de Campos e Santos

Renata Alvarenga; David Iacopini; Patrycia Ene; Claiton M. S. Scherer; Karin Goldberg

Apresentando reservatorios em aguas profundas, o pre-sal das bacias de Campos e Santos e um cenario com depositos heterogeneos e complexos, e assim traz novos desafios para a interpretacao sismica. O presente trabalho tem como objetivo a caracterizacao sismica do intervalo rifte (de idade Hauteriviano Superior ao Barremiano, imediatamente abaixo dos reservatorios pre- -sal) nas bacias de Campos e Santos com a utilizacao de dados de sismica 2D e dois perfis de pocos. Foram analisadas as texturas sismicas e com a integracao dos dados litologicos se definiu tres sismofacies correspondentes: Sismofacies 1 (deposito de falha de borda) – apresenta comportamento semelhante em ambas as bacias e com ocorrencia encaixada na falha de borda em uma zona ampla e bem definida; Sismofacies 2 (deposito de sedimentos finos) – amplamente identificada nas bacias de Campos e Santos e que grada lateralmente para a sismofacies 3; Sismofacies 3 (deposito de grainstones e rudstones ) – em ambas as bacias tem ocorrencia restrita e de ocorrencia erratica, tanto em zonas altas da margem flexural, quanto nas zonas profundas proximas do depocentro dos meio-grabens analisados.

Primary composition and diagenetic patterns of sandstones from Barra de Itiúba Formation in Atalaia High, Sergipe Sub-Basin

Amanda Goulart Rodrigues; Karin Goldberg

The petrologic analyses of 40 thin sections from two wells located in Atalaia High, offshore of Sergipe Sub-Basin, allowed the identification of primary composition and diagenetic patterns of Barra de Itiuba Formation. The original detrital compositions included arkoses, sublithic, and lithic sandstones. The main diagenetic processes observed were: compaction of metamorphic rock fragments and mud intraclasts, generating pseudomatrix; precipitation of quartz and feldspar overgrowths and outgrowths, cementation and grain replacement by kaolinite; dolomite and ferrous dolomite/ankerite; pyrite; iron oxides and hydroxides; and diagenetic titanium minerals, in addition to dissolution phases during eo-, meso- and telogenesis. The macroporosity in the two studied wells is primary intergranular, but there is secondary porosity due to dissolution of primary and diagenetic constituents, as well as fracture porosity. Thirteen reservoir petrofacies were defined and grouped into four reservoir petrofacies associations. They reflect the reservoir quality in microscale: good, medium and low-quality and non-reservoir. The good-quality is characterized by average total porosity greater than 15%, whereas the medium shows average total porosity greater than 7%. Low-quality presents average total porosity between 1 and 4%, and the non-reservoir has an average total porosity consistently less than 1%. Overall, the studied reservoirs consist on low-quality and non-reservoir rocks, which are intercalated with levels of medium- and good-quality. The loss of original porosity was mainly due to mechanical compaction (generating pseudomatrix), and cementation by kaolinite and dolomite. Preservation of primary porosity was favored by the presence of quartz overgrowths.
